What Do Factory Workers Do?

Factory workers are responsible for helping with the production and packaging of goods. Their tasks may vary depending on the type of factory.

Common responsibilities include:

  • Operating basic machines

  • Assembling products

  • Packaging finished goods

  • Checking product quality

  • Preparing items for shipment

Factories often provide training for new employees.


🇨🇦 Manufacturing Jobs in Canada

Canada has a large manufacturing sector that produces food products, electronics, automotive parts, and consumer goods.

Factory jobs in Canada may include:

  • Production line workers

  • Packaging assistants

  • Machine operators

  • Quality control assistants

Some companies may offer temporary work permits for foreign workers depending on labor shortages.


🇩🇪 Industrial Jobs in Germany

Germany is one of the largest manufacturing economies in Europe. Its factories produce vehicles, machinery, and industrial equipment.

Because of workforce shortages, many companies recruit international workers for factory and industrial roles.

Basic German language skills may improve employment opportunities.


🇵🇱 Factory Opportunities in Poland

Poland has become a growing destination for foreign workers in manufacturing. Many factories hire workers for:

  • Food processing

  • Packaging

  • Electronics assembly

  • Warehouse and logistics support

These jobs often provide entry-level opportunities.


Requirements for Factory Jobs

Most factory jobs have simple requirements such as:

  • Basic physical fitness

  • Ability to follow instructions

  • Willingness to work in shifts

  • Teamwork skills

Previous experience in production or manufacturing can be helpful but is not always necessary.


Tips for Applying Safely

When applying for factory jobs abroad:

  • Use trusted job websites

  • Check the company’s background

  • Avoid paying money for job offers

  • Verify visa and work permit requirements

  • Read employment contracts carefully
